Mayorga Robusto H2000 Review
I smoked this puppy yesterday.
Great construction. a beautiful box press that is easy to hold onto when playing frisbee. A nice solid cigar that burns evenly. The ash was white and held one for over an inch, even though I was jumping up and down. The cigar let out lots of thich smoke too. I found this cigar very hard to describe. I can't really put a name on any of the flavors I tasted. I can say the it is a great smoke. Worth the money. I still prefer the Maduro but the H2000 is still a great smoke. I know that many people don't like the H2000 wrapper, but I urge you to give the mayorgas a try. They aren't as harsh as some of the other H2000 smokes I've had. big_bish
